The diameter of your bicycle wheel is 34 inches. What is it’s radius

The diameter of a circle (or in this case a bicycle wheel) is how long it is from one side of the circle striaght across to the other side.  The radius is half the diameter.  So if the diameter is 34, then the radius would be 17.
